I can honestly say that something happened to me for the first time today – which at my age you don’t get to say that often! – and it was having an earful of hailstones! Phew! Nature filled my orifice with freezing diamonds in a matter of seconds as we townees (Paul and I) joined James and Ivor on an ill-advised gambol on the Downs in Brighton. It was hilarious (Paul’s yet to see the funny side but he will, he will..) how the day went from bright, breezy and bracing to 2012 GLOBAL CATACLYSM and we were stuck out in the middle of a field, completely exposed with nowhere to hide…just like John Cusack and Thandie Newton I imagine…..

But the best part was shivering and shaking our way back to James’ where I could chuck my WW1 nurses dress into the tumbler without too much worry and Paul, eyeing his vintage Yohji trousers gingerly folded them over a towel rail. We got cosy in front of the fire in robes and bedsocks, talked of Josephine Baker, Gaby Deslys, Stephen Tennant, Erté, oh all manner of gay banter while drinking cracking coffee out of bone china tea cups and eating mighty fine omelettes…simple pleasures…and back to town in time to pick the boys up from school! It’s unbelievable that you can be in Brighton in under an hour and when we make the effort it’s so envigorating (perhaps a bit too envigorating today!) to get out of town even for a morning. So James kindly scanned one of his many incredible JB photographs for me – in fact I kept his arty crop – and she’s Madame’s flyer star for tomorrow night at the George and Dragon…do hope to see you there.
